Abstract
In this study, we show that, the unidirectional chaos synchronization can be obtained by using a non-generating partition to divide the phase space. Moreover, when using a non-generating partition to attain the chaos synchronization, the minimum required communication channel capacity is hβhβ, which is less than the KS entropy of the drive system hKShKS. However, the minimum synchronization error cannot be arbitrarily small. Simulations are provided to validate our results.
